George Hamilton
George Stevens Hamilton is a prominent American actor known for his work in both film and television. He embarked on his cinematic journey in 1958 and has since cultivated an impressive portfolio, but he is perhaps best recognized for his charming demeanor and signature tan. In her autobiography, Bo Derek humorously recounts a friendly rivalry between her husband, John Derek, and Hamilton regarding who could achieve a deeper tan.
Throughout his career, Hamilton has starred in a variety of notable films, including "Home from the Hill," "By Love Possessed," "Light in the Piazza," "Your Cheatin' Heart," "Once Is Not Enough," and the comedic hit "Love at First Bite." He also appeared in "Zorro, The Gay Blade," "The Godfather Part III" (1990), "Doc Hollywood," "8 Heads in a Duffel Bag," "Hollywood Ending," and "The Congressman."
Hamilton's talent was recognized early on when he received a Golden Globe Award for his debut in "Crime and Punishment U.S.A." Additionally, he earned a BAFTA nomination for this performance, along with another BAFTA nomination and two further Golden Globe nominations over the course of his illustrious career.
